Toddler daycare is actually a common option for many moms and dads in the present society. Using increasing quantity of dual-income households and single-parent people, the need for trustworthy and high-quality childcare for babies is much more prevalent than in the past. Here, we shall explore the advantages and challenges of baby daycare, including its impact on kid development, socialization, and parental wellbeing.
Advantages of Toddler Daycare
Among the primary great things about baby daycare may be the chance of kids to socialize with their colleagues young. Studies have shown that youthful babies which attend daycare have better personal abilities and generally are more likely to form safe attachments with grownups also young ones. This early exposure to social interactions can really help infants develop essential social and psychological abilities which will benefit them in their life.
Besides socialization, infant daycare may also provide a safe and stimulating environment for kids to learn and develop. Numerous daycare services provide age-appropriate activities and educational possibilities that can help babies develop cognitive, motor, and language abilities. By doing these tasks on a daily basis, infants can reach important developmental milestones quicker and efficiently than should they had been acquainted with a parent or caregiver.
Furthermore, baby daycare may also be very theraputic for moms and dads. Challenges of Infant Daycare
Regardless of the many benefits of baby daycare, there are difficulties that parents and providers must consider. One of several main difficulties could be the possibility of separation anxiety in babies who aren't always becoming from their particular primary caregiver. This will probably lead to distress and emotional upheaval for both the son or daughter in addition to mother or father, making the change to daycare hard for every person involved.
Another challenge of infant daycare could be the possibility of experience of infection. Younger infants have actually building protected methods which are not however completely prepared to manage the germs and viruses that are common in daycare configurations. This will probably trigger frequent health problems and missed days of work for parents, and increased tension and be concerned about the youngster's health.
Furthermore, the expense of infant daycare could be prohibitive for all families. The large price of quality childcare are an important economic burden, especially for low-income households or people that have multiple kiddies. This can induce difficult choices about whether or not to enroll a child in daycare or for one parent to stay residence and forgo potential earnings.
Summary
In conclusion, baby daycare could be a brilliant option for many people, providing young ones with socialization, stimulation, and mastering possibilities that may support their particular development. But is important for parents to carefully look at the benefits and challenges of daycare before carefully deciding. By evaluating the good qualities and disadvantages and finding a high-quality daycare supplier that meets their needs, moms and dads can ensure that their child receives perfect treatment and help during this important stage of development.
